WWII Victory Gardens

The San Ramon Valley has a rich agricultural history. In addition to growing hays, grains, fruits, and nuts, ranchers and farmers had family gardens. During WWII, they were called Victory Gardens. Hear from a history gardening specialist about Victory Gardens and from a master gardener about how to create and grow a kitchen garden. They will demonstrate "canning, then and now" and share historic recipes. Join us for this fascinating presentation and preview the Museum's Victory Garden exhibit to be held July 23–September 18, 2010.
